CVE-2026-10051

In Eclipse Jetty, a first HTTP/1.1 request with trailers causes the server to retain the trailers in subsequent requests performed over the same connection. Subsequent request that do not have trailers report the trailers of the first request. Subsequent request that do have trailers report the union of trailers of the first request and the current request.

Vulnerable Versions
  • from 12 through 12.0.35
  • from 12.1 through 12.1.9
Vulnerable Versions Count30 versions ( 14% of all versions)


Common Weakness Enumeration

CWE-200 Exposure of Sensitive Information to an Unauthorized Actor
